Composed Tommy Fleetwood is adamant his American breakthrough can finally come as he’s not crashed and burned in his recent heartbreaking near-misses in the States.
The English star is back in contention once again at the Tour Championship and sits joint-leader at the East Lake halfway stage.
Despite seven career wins on the DP World Tour, Fleetwood has agonisingly been denied success in the USA with close shaves this term.
The European Ryder Cup hero, who will join Rory McIlroy and his team-mates at Bethpage, believes he’s finally storm through the door if he keeps knocking hard and believes he’s performing to the standard capable of making it happen.
